Our Client, a Banking company, is looking for a Bilingual Senior Talent Sourcer - French Speaking for their Montréal, QC/Hybrid location.
Responsibilities:
- Prepares target lists with recruiters and hiring managers and develops sourcing strategies for each requisition and pipeline project.
- Sourcing, qualifying, and presenting candidates to the Recruiter, adhering to Service Level Guidelines.
- Represents the Client’s brand to prospects.
- Develops knowledge of current market trends.
- Initial candidate contact, building relationships and networks to generate leads and assess candidate suitability.
- Manages applicant tracking system and maintains accurate candidate documentation for legal compliance.
- Ensures compliance with EEO/Diversity Programs.
- Builds a network of top talent and assesses candidates for role alignment.
- Uses effective communication to keep the recruiter informed and express ideas clearly and timely.
Requirements:
- Experience in recruiting or staffing, preferably in research, sourcing, or executive search.
- 4+ years of full-time talent sourcing or recruitment experience supporting Finance, Retail, High Volume, Executive, Insurance, or Technology roles.
- Proficiency in various sourcing methodologies including social networking, sourcing tools, job boards, and internet networking.
- Expertise in data analysis and market intelligence presentation using Microsoft Office tools.
- Experience in client and internal partner management.
- Experience working with KPIs in result-driven environments.
- Experience with applicant tracking systems and Boolean search strings.
- Proven success in external headhunting.
- Ability to work independently and meet deadlines.
- Experience presenting data and market insights.
- University Degree preferred.
- Strong verbal and written communication skills in both English and French.
- 5+ years in data analysis, market intel, and Boolean search.
- Headhunting/Sourcing experience in corporate or agency settings for 5+ years.
- 5+ years of recruitment experience.
- 1+ year of agency recruitment experience.
- Banking industry experience.
- 1+ year of IT recruitment experience.
